Entry & Eligibility Information
Entries Open: Wednesday, October 15, 2025 at 9:00 AM
Entries Close: Wednesday, November 12, 2025 at 5:00 PM
Entry Fee: $300
Eligibility: Players must have a current membership with a member of the Texas Junior Golf Alliance. Players can renew or sign up with the Northern Texas PGA or the Southern Texas PGA membership to be eligible to play.
Entry Procedure: Players will be added to the field according to the Priority Entry System immediately following the close of registration. For more information, please check the Eligibility & Entry Procedures on the LJT landing page.
Championship Information
Format/Field Size: Play will be contested over 36 holes of stroke play. The field is limited to 84 players.
Divisions: Boys 12-18, Girls 12-18
Practice Round Information: The official practice round date is Friday, December 5th. Players may begin contacting the club beginning Friday, November 28th to schedule a practice round.

Starting Times/Pairings Information
Starting times/pairings for the first round will be made no later than Wednesday, December 3rd. Pairings will be listed online on the tournament homepage. Final round starting times/pairings will be available in the evening following the completion of the first round. Final round starting times/pairings will be re-drawn based on total score following the previous rounds of play.
